What are some tips for making the most of the Des Moines Home and Garden Show?

To make the most of your experience, consider these tips:

  • Plan your visit: Review the show's website before you go to familiarize yourself with the exhibitors and plan your route.
  • Bring a notebook and pen: Take notes on products, vendors, and ideas that interest you.
  • Wear comfortable shoes: You'll be doing a lot of walking!
  • Take breaks: The show can be overwhelming, so take some time to rest and recharge.
  • Talk to the experts: Engage with the exhibitors and ask questions – this is a fantastic opportunity to get personalized advice.
  • Set a budget: Knowing your budget beforehand will help you make informed decisions.
